I was excited to snag a Crumpler bag at this great price for my new 13.3" MacBook. The green color is, happily, a little darker and richer (more olive, less lime) than it looked on the web. The bag is bigger than I expected, probably so it can accommodate slightly bigger laptops. My Mac doesn't fit quite the internal sleeve snugly--it's just a little loose. For a short person (I'm 5')") the bag itself is a little long and the shortest strap adjustment is not quite as short as would be ideal. The padded shoulder strap is a nice touch. The biggest thing missing is a secure little pocket for that accessory plug/adaptor thingy, which seems like it's going to float around in either the big main compartment or the slightly smaller outside pocket and get lost. The construction is really good. Other reviewers mention the big, loud velcro, and that's definitely true! The inside flap is long, so getting ahold of it when other stuff is packed into the bag (it's big enough to fit file folders) is awkward. Overall I'm pleased with the quality and features. I just wish it was a little smaller/shorter and had a mini-pocket.

I think the picture is of the "Breakfast Buffet" bag, which is proportioned differently. This bag is a vertical messenger bag, not squarish, as in the picture. I measure mine at 15"x13"x4.5". This bag is amazingly well made and very funky. I love it for those things. It's very well padded... maybe too much so for my uses. The padding seems to take up a large hunk of the potential capacity of the bag. It holds my 15" PowerBook with plenty of room to spare vertically... but without a lot of extra room for books and papers. It has no easily accessible pockets, which makes it a bad commuter or travelling bag for me... I need access to things like keys, eye glasses, and tickets. (Others would find this great because everything's securely in the bag.) And yet, I love it. Just not the right commuter bag for me. FYI: Mine is blue; the lining is gold/orange.
